    Unhappy Empty Box

    We finally got the boat out for the first time this year, more a test run then fishing trip. Good news is the boat and all its passengers returned safely – Bad news returned empty handed.
    We left Walnut about 5:00 pm heading west for the Ohio boarder, turned the boat around and trolled with the waves. Marked a few scattered fish here and there but no large schools. We pulled Harnesses, spoons and Reef Runners.
    Rumor at Poor Richards was big fish were taken yesterday (6/22) west of Walnut.

    Default Walnut

    After three hour drive, We left walnut creek at 730 on the Reel Overtime and headed west to about elk again, turned east and started to slide, at 58' we made three passes only to catch three walleye, Bare naked, 2oz at 50, than 50-60 and on the board. all fish were high, lost one fighter near the boat. than we went for perch about noon, found 16 that wanted to come home. nice day on the lake.
    Good luck to all.
